Explore medieval history at Dundalk's Castle Roche, where dramatic ruins offer sweeping views across the Cooley Peninsula. Discover local heritage at the County Museum, then catch a performance at An Táin Arts Centre or sample craft beers at the Brewery Tap.

Shopping

In Dundalk, explore Northlink Retail Park and Dundalk Retail Park, both offering a mix of family-friendly shops and local businesses. If you're up for a drive, Navan Town Centre, 43.5km away, features a vibrant atmosphere with diverse shopping options for gifts and souvenirs.

Recreation

Experience the vibrant atmosphere at Oriel Park, where you can enjoy various sports activities. For a leisurely day, head to Dundalk Golf Club, nestled in picturesque surroundings. For ultimate relaxation, indulge in treatments at Halo Beauty Haven, where wellness meets tranquility.

Adventure

Experience a splash of fun at Funtasia Waterpark, located 33.8km from Dundalk, with thrilling slides and family-friendly attractions. For a scenic adventure, trek the Girley Bog Eco Walk, 37.0km away, where you can enjoy stunning landscapes and immerse yourself in nature.

Nightlife

Dundalk's nightlife offers a blend of culture and fun. Catch a show at the Mac Anna Theatre for a romantic evening, or if you're up for an adventure, take a trip to The Zone, an arcade adventure zone just 45.1km away, perfect for family fun.

Best time to go to Dundalk

The best time to visit Dundalk can depend on the weather and when visitor numbers rise and fall. The hottest average temperature in Dundalk falls in July, when visitor numbers are slightly high and weather is mostly cloudy with light rain. The coolest average temperature in Dundalk falls in January, visitor numbers are average and weather is mostly cloudy with light rain.

What's the weather like in Dundalk?

The hottest months are usually July and August, with an average temperature of 14°C, while the coldest months are January and February, with an average of 5°C. Average annual precipitation for Dundalk is 903 mm.
